Why Generator Reliability Matters in This Climate

Shreveport’s humid subtropical climate brings severe thunderstorms and damaging winds throughout spring and summer, along with occasional hurricane remnants that dump heavy rain and knock out power for hours or days. When temperatures climb into the mid-90s and the air is thick with humidity, losing air conditioning isn’t just uncomfortable; it becomes a health and safety issue for vulnerable family members. Freezers full of food spoil, sump pumps stop running, and medical devices go dark.

A backup generator is your insurance policy against these outages, but only if it actually starts and runs when called upon. Generators that sit idle for months between storms often fail at the worst possible moment due to stale fuel, dead batteries, corroded connections, or control board faults. Regular professional maintenance and prompt repair when issues appear keep your standby system ready to protect your home the instant utility power drops. In a region where outages are a question of when, not if, generator reliability directly affects your family’s safety and comfort.

When It’s Time for Generator Repair

Your generator gives clear warning signs when it needs professional attention:

  • Generator won’t start during a test run or real outage
  • Engine cranks but fails to fire or stay running
  • Rough idle, stalling, or shutting down unexpectedly under load
  • Low voltage output or flickering lights when the generator is running
  • Warning lights, fault codes, or error messages on the control panel
  • Excessive noise, vibration, or smoke during operation
  • Fuel leaks, oil leaks, or coolant leaks around the unit
  • Transfer switch doesn’t engage or switch power properly

Repair vs. Replacement: When to Upgrade Your Generator

Not every generator problem requires a new unit. Many common failures, such as dead batteries, clogged carburetors, faulty sensors, or failed capacitors, are straightforward repairs that restore years of reliable service at a fraction of replacement cost. If your generator is less than ten years old and has been properly maintained, repair is often the smarter choice.

However, if your generator is very old, has major engine or alternator damage, or requires expensive parts that approach the cost of a new unit, replacement may offer better long-term value and reliability. Similarly, if your home’s electrical load has grown since the original install and the generator can no longer handle the demand, upgrading to a larger unit makes sense. Most manufacturers and electricians recommend annual professional maintenance for standby generators, typically before storm season in spring. Regular service includes oil and filter changes, battery checks, fuel system inspection, and test runs under load. Preventive maintenance catches small issues before they become expensive failures and ensures your generator starts reliably when you need it.
Common causes include a dead battery, stale or contaminated fuel, a tripped breaker or fuse, a faulty starter, or a problem with the automatic transfer switch that signals the generator to start.
